What is remote lidar data processing?

Remote LiDAR data processing involves handling and analyzing L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) data from a location other than where the data was collected. Professionals use specialized software to process large datasets, extract features like terrain models or vegetation, and generate 2D or 3D representations of landscapes. This remote work setup allows teams to collaborate globally, efficiently process data for industries like mapping, forestry, and urban planning, and deliver results without being physically present at the survey site.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in remote lidar data processing?

To thrive as a Remote Lidar Data Processing Specialist, you need a solid background in geospatial sciences, data analysis, and remote sensing, often supported by a relevant degree such as geography, GIS, or engineering. Familiarity with specialized software like LAStools, ArcGIS, and Global Mapper, as well as experience with data formats such as LAS and point cloud processing, is typ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ication are essential soft skills for ensuring data accuracy and collaborating with team members. These skills and qualifications are important because they enable precise data interpretation, efficient workflow, and the delivery of high-quality geospatial products to clients.

A.I.S., Inc. (AIS) is a national scientific services firm supporting maritime activities requiring certification of compliance with environmental regulation ns as well as collecting data for use by Federal, State, Municipal, and other government agencies along the US coastline. AIS is seeking a Data Scientist to support NOAAs SEFSC Advanced Technology and Innovation Branch.


Primary Function:

This role supports the integration, processing, and analysis of diverse data types to improve scientific understanding and operational efficiency across SEFSC survey programs. This position is contingent upon contract award and available funding.


Duties/Responsibilities:

  • Manage, organize, and support analysis of multi-source datasets collected across SEFSC surveys, including acoustic, video, environmental DNA, multibeam, and aerial imagery data
  • Coordinate with project partners to ensure data collection and sensor configurations support downstream analytical and AI/ML applications
  • Maintain familiarity with diverse data types and assist with field data collection activities as needed
  • Organize and document datasets and metadata in accordance with established data management protocols
  • Perform QA/QC on incoming datasets and evaluate suitability for inclusion in advanced analytical workflows
  • Support data curation and storage, including cloud-based data repositories
  • Assist with preparation and archiving of datasets in accordance with government data standards
  • Develop, test, and evaluate analytical workflows and models to improve data processing efficiency
  • Support annotation of datasets and development of machine learning models, including training and validation of classifiers and detection systems
  • Generate data products suitable for use by downstream scientific stakeholders (e.g., stock assessment scientists)
  • Maintain awareness of SEFSC analytical needs and existing workflows to align data science efforts with mission priorities
  • Participate in interdisciplinary working groups and collaborative research efforts
  • Support proposal development, manuscript review, and scientific reporting activities
  • Participate in outreach and stakeholder engagement activities as required
  • Prepare for and participate in scientific meetings, workshops, and symposia
